Job Description

Primary

Purpose:

Functions in a technician capacity, working primarily in the field, to gather data for engineering and design of aerial, underground, and buried fiber optic facilities. This position requires frequent travel around suburban Dublin/San Jose and occasionally other metro areas. Although this position predominantly involves field work, it will also require completion of administrative tasks as required by project leadership. Based on experience, skill level, and project needs, there is a potential for this position to move over into more complex field data collection.

Principal

Duties and Responsibilities

This job will be a long term contract with possibility to convert to full time based in Dublin, CA and entails field work around suburban Dublin/San Jose/Bay Area and occasionally other metro areas in N. Cal to take pictures, measurements, document existing facilities, and obtain design information in preparation for OSP network design.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Minimum of 1 year related work experience.
  • Individual must be available to mobilize when scheduled and possess a valid driver’s license with a clean motor vehicle report.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, etc…).
  • Ability to work outside in varying weather conditions.
  • Must be able to stand, bend, squat, walk, move, lift, carry… equipment (>20lb) for the duration of the work day.
Preferred Job Qualifications
  • Diploma or Certificate preferred.
  • OSP/ISP or Fiber data collection/site walk experience. If not, then utility field experience.
